Volatile adducts of uranyl nitrate. Sublimation and mass spectra
Description
Adducts of uranyl nitrate with strong neutral ligands: trimethyl phosphate (TMP), triethyl phosphate (TEP), trimethylphosphine oxide (TMPO), hexamethylphosphoric triamide (HMPTA), with a 1:2 composition, and phenanthroline (phen) (with a 1:1 composition), and also a complex with a composition of UO2(NO3) (NCS) x 2HMPTA were synthesized. The above enumerated compounds sublime in vacuo (adducts with TMP and TEP in a vapor current of the corresponding trialkyl phosphate) with a partial decomposition at temperatures of 160-2800C. A mass-spectrometric examination of the complexes synthesized has been carried out. It was shown that after splitting off of the ligand, the fragmentation of the adducts with TMPO and phen proceeds by the path consisting in splitting off of the NO2 group, while in the case of an adduct with TEP, a rearrangement takes places with the elimination of C2H5NO3. The last path is similar to the processes proceeding during the thermal decomposition of UO2(NO3)2 x 2TBP
